The management of emotional competencies continues to gain ground as a key to successful leadership, even in the institutional environment.
I am very proud to share that from RIEEB – International Network of Emotional Education and Wellbeing (where I have the honor of being part of the board of directors, as well as directing its “Postgraduate in Coaching and Emotional Leadership”) we have signed an agreement with the Diputació de Barcelona to work together in the training of leaders and professionals of local authorities.
This agreement not only reinforces the importance of emotional competencies in the public sector, but also underscores their transformative role in any professional environment, such as business. Because better prepared leaders mean more cohesive teams and more effective organizations.
